Quick Assessment

This board book introduces young readers to a variety of colors using real-life images, making it an engaging tool for early learning. Designed for ages 5 to 8, it supports color recognition and vocabulary development in an accessible format. Its simple, clear presentation is well-suited for early readers and toddlers alike.
